ABSTRACT:
A magnetic bubble propagation device comprising a pattern of magnetic material formed of the so-called gap tolerant elements, positioned over a bubble supporting material to define a bubble propagation path. Each element of the pattern is spaced from the bubble material such that a gradient is formed in the spacing between the element and the bubble material in the direction of the propagation path. A rotating magnetic field of sufficient strength to magnetize the pattern is applied in the plane of the material and the spacing gradient causes the bubble to move from one element to an adjacent element in one complete field rotation. This device is particularly characterized in that, with the combination of the pattern elements and the spacing gradient thereof, the gaps between the elements are eliminated.
